How replace a vetchsolonide on 2000 Honda civic

It is quite simple to replace the VTEC Solenoid assembly. It is located on the rear right upper side of cylinder head (right side with reference with if sitting if driver's seat) on the intake side. It is attached to the head by means of 6mm bolts. Just remove the connector (NOTE: It my have single VTEC solnoid or two, depending on the model), remove the bolts and take out the solenoid. Please see the diagram:

93 honda civc idle control

fast idle thermo valve located by the throtle body with coolant hoses remove valve and adjust plastic washer its under a cover with 2 bolts good luck
